Management Discussion And Analysis Overall review,

Industry Structure and Developments:

As mentioned in the Directors report, your Directors are hopeful of achieving a steady growth in sales and job work activity and resultant net margin in the years to follow. In the current scenario the Board believed that Indian market will offers the opportunities for the revival of the product.

Opportunities and Threat

The opportunities in the domestic market is large though at the moment it is also affected by the economic scenario the world over. But we believe it is a passing phase and the signs of recovery are already there. By the time the Company launches its plans it is expected that the economic recovery would be well on its way.

Segment wise Performance

The Company does not have multiple products / segments

Out look

The Board is positive on the future outlook of the company and is examining various business options.

Internal control System

Company at brsent has internal control procedures, which is commensurate with the brsent requirements. Internal controls are being monitored, reviewed and upgraded on an ongoing basis.

Human relations

The Board is keen to have a fully equipped HR Department, once the activity is started in a big way. During the year under review, the activities were in a minimal scale and manpower utilization was meager and so there was no need for such a department.

Caution

The views exbrssed in the Management Discussions and Analysis are based on available information, assessments and judgment. They are subject to alterations. The Company's actual perfor­mance may differ due to national or international ramifications, government regulations, policies, Tax Laws, and other unforeseen factors over which the Company may not have any control.

RISK DISCLOSURES ON DERIVATIVES

  • 9 out of 10 individual traders in equity Futures and Options Segment, incurred net losses.
  • On an average, loss makers registered net trading loss close to ₹ 50,000.
  • Over and above the net trading losses incurred, loss makers expended an additional 28% of net trading losses as transaction costs.
  • Those making net trading profits, incurred between 15% to 50% of such profits as transaction cost.
